diff --git a/.github/workflows/release.yaml b/.github/workflows/release.yaml
index 1c45bef..6c999d4 100644
--- a/.github/workflows/release.yaml
+++ b/.github/workflows/release.yaml
@@ -22,8 +22,12 @@ jobs:
- name: Install Cosign
uses: sigstore/cosign-installer@v3.5.0
+ - name: Set up QEMU
+ uses: docker/setup-qemu-action@v3
+ with:
+ platforms: arm64
- name: Set up docker buildx
- run: make docker-init
+ uses: docker/setup-buildx-action@v3
- name: Github registry login
uses: docker/login-action@v3
diff --git a/CHANGELOG.md b/CHANGELOG.md
index c7e83b6..de75abe 100644
--- a/CHANGELOG.md
+++ b/CHANGELOG.md
@@ -1,8 +1,8 @@
-
-## [v0.4.1](https://github.com/sergelogvinov/proxmox-cloud-controller-manager/compare/v0.4.0...v0.4.1) (2024-05-04)
+
+## [v0.4.2](https://github.com/sergelogvinov/proxmox-cloud-controller-manager/compare/v0.4.0...v0.4.2) (2024-05-04)
-Welcome to the v0.4.1 release of Kubernetes cloud controller manager for Proxmox!
+Welcome to the v0.4.2 release of Kubernetes cloud controller manager for Proxmox!
### Features
@@ -11,6 +11,7 @@ Welcome to the v0.4.1 release of Kubernetes cloud controller manager for Proxmox
### Changelog
+* c02bc2f chore: release v0.4.1
* ce92b3e feat(chart): add daemonset mode
* 4771769 chore: bump deps
* 12d2858 ci: update multi arch build init
diff --git a/charts/proxmox-cloud-controller-manager/Chart.yaml b/charts/proxmox-cloud-controller-manager/Chart.yaml
index 627d305..8266171 100644
--- a/charts/proxmox-cloud-controller-manager/Chart.yaml
+++ b/charts/proxmox-cloud-controller-manager/Chart.yaml
@@ -14,9 +14,9 @@ maintainers:
# This is the chart version. This version number should be incremented each time you make changes
# to the chart and its templates, including the app version.
# Versions are expected to follow Semantic Versioning (https://semver.org/)
-version: 0.2.2
+version: 0.2.3
# This is the version number of the application being deployed. This version number should be
# incremented each time you make changes to the application. Versions are not expected to
# follow Semantic Versioning. They should reflect the version the application is using.
# It is recommended to use it with quotes.
-appVersion: v0.4.1
+appVersion: v0.4.2
diff --git a/charts/proxmox-cloud-controller-manager/README.md b/charts/proxmox-cloud-controller-manager/README.md
index e200ded..228850d 100644
--- a/charts/proxmox-cloud-controller-manager/README.md
+++ b/charts/proxmox-cloud-controller-manager/README.md
@@ -1,6 +1,6 @@
# proxmox-cloud-controller-manager
-![Version: 0.2.2](https://img.shields.io/badge/Version-0.2.2-informational?style=flat-square) ![Type: application](https://img.shields.io/badge/Type-application-informational?style=flat-square) ![AppVersion: v0.4.1](https://img.shields.io/badge/AppVersion-v0.4.1-informational?style=flat-square)
+![Version: 0.2.3](https://img.shields.io/badge/Version-0.2.3-informational?style=flat-square) ![Type: application](https://img.shields.io/badge/Type-application-informational?style=flat-square) ![AppVersion: v0.4.2](https://img.shields.io/badge/AppVersion-v0.4.2-informational?style=flat-square)
A Helm chart for Kubernetes
diff --git a/docs/deploy/cloud-controller-manager-daemonset.yml b/docs/deploy/cloud-controller-manager-daemonset.yml
index 73cb799..1a5dbbb 100644
--- a/docs/deploy/cloud-controller-manager-daemonset.yml
+++ b/docs/deploy/cloud-controller-manager-daemonset.yml
@@ -5,10 +5,10 @@ kind: ServiceAccount
metadata:
name: proxmox-cloud-controller-manager
labels:
- helm.sh/chart: proxmox-cloud-controller-manager-0.2.2
+ helm.sh/chart: proxmox-cloud-controller-manager-0.2.3
app.kubernetes.io/name: proxmox-cloud-controller-manager
app.kubernetes.io/instance: proxmox-cloud-controller-manager
- app.kubernetes.io/version: "v0.4.1"
+ app.kubernetes.io/version: "v0.4.2"
app.kubernetes.io/managed-by: Helm
namespace: kube-system
---
@@ -18,10 +18,10 @@ kind: ClusterRole
metadata:
name: system:proxmox-cloud-controller-manager
labels:
- helm.sh/chart: proxmox-cloud-controller-manager-0.2.2
+ helm.sh/chart: proxmox-cloud-controller-manager-0.2.3
app.kubernetes.io/name: proxmox-cloud-controller-manager
app.kubernetes.io/instance: proxmox-cloud-controller-manager
- app.kubernetes.io/version: "v0.4.1"
+ app.kubernetes.io/version: "v0.4.2"
app.kubernetes.io/managed-by: Helm
rules:
- apiGroups:
@@ -106,10 +106,10 @@ kind: DaemonSet
metadata:
name: proxmox-cloud-controller-manager
labels:
- helm.sh/chart: proxmox-cloud-controller-manager-0.2.2
+ helm.sh/chart: proxmox-cloud-controller-manager-0.2.3
app.kubernetes.io/name: proxmox-cloud-controller-manager
app.kubernetes.io/instance: proxmox-cloud-controller-manager
- app.kubernetes.io/version: "v0.4.1"
+ app.kubernetes.io/version: "v0.4.2"
app.kubernetes.io/managed-by: Helm
namespace: kube-system
spec:
@@ -149,7 +149,7 @@ spec:
- ALL
seccompProfile:
type: RuntimeDefault
- image: "ghcr.io/sergelogvinov/proxmox-cloud-controller-manager:v0.4.1"
+ image: "ghcr.io/sergelogvinov/proxmox-cloud-controller-manager:v0.4.2"
imagePullPolicy: IfNotPresent
args:
- --v=2
diff --git a/docs/deploy/cloud-controller-manager-talos.yml b/docs/deploy/cloud-controller-manager-talos.yml
index c6a312b..ee0d7ac 100644
--- a/docs/deploy/cloud-controller-manager-talos.yml
+++ b/docs/deploy/cloud-controller-manager-talos.yml
@@ -5,10 +5,10 @@ kind: ServiceAccount
metadata:
name: proxmox-cloud-controller-manager
labels:
- helm.sh/chart: proxmox-cloud-controller-manager-0.2.2
+ helm.sh/chart: proxmox-cloud-controller-manager-0.2.3
app.kubernetes.io/name: proxmox-cloud-controller-manager
app.kubernetes.io/instance: proxmox-cloud-controller-manager
- app.kubernetes.io/version: "v0.4.1"
+ app.kubernetes.io/version: "v0.4.2"
app.kubernetes.io/managed-by: Helm
namespace: kube-system
---
@@ -18,10 +18,10 @@ kind: ClusterRole
metadata:
name: system:proxmox-cloud-controller-manager
labels:
- helm.sh/chart: proxmox-cloud-controller-manager-0.2.2
+ helm.sh/chart: proxmox-cloud-controller-manager-0.2.3
app.kubernetes.io/name: proxmox-cloud-controller-manager
app.kubernetes.io/instance: proxmox-cloud-controller-manager
- app.kubernetes.io/version: "v0.4.1"
+ app.kubernetes.io/version: "v0.4.2"
app.kubernetes.io/managed-by: Helm
rules:
- apiGroups:
@@ -106,10 +106,10 @@ kind: Deployment
metadata:
name: proxmox-cloud-controller-manager
labels:
- helm.sh/chart: proxmox-cloud-controller-manager-0.2.2
+ helm.sh/chart: proxmox-cloud-controller-manager-0.2.3
app.kubernetes.io/name: proxmox-cloud-controller-manager
app.kubernetes.io/instance: proxmox-cloud-controller-manager
- app.kubernetes.io/version: "v0.4.1"
+ app.kubernetes.io/version: "v0.4.2"
app.kubernetes.io/managed-by: Helm
namespace: kube-system
spec:
@@ -148,7 +148,7 @@ spec:
- ALL
seccompProfile:
type: RuntimeDefault
- image: "ghcr.io/sergelogvinov/proxmox-cloud-controller-manager:v0.4.1"
+ image: "ghcr.io/sergelogvinov/proxmox-cloud-controller-manager:v0.4.2"
imagePullPolicy: IfNotPresent
args:
- --v=4
diff --git a/docs/deploy/cloud-controller-manager.yml b/docs/deploy/cloud-controller-manager.yml
index e2377bb..e784b34 100644
--- a/docs/deploy/cloud-controller-manager.yml
+++ b/docs/deploy/cloud-controller-manager.yml
@@ -5,10 +5,10 @@ kind: ServiceAccount
metadata:
name: proxmox-cloud-controller-manager
labels:
- helm.sh/chart: proxmox-cloud-controller-manager-0.2.2
+ helm.sh/chart: proxmox-cloud-controller-manager-0.2.3
app.kubernetes.io/name: proxmox-cloud-controller-manager
app.kubernetes.io/instance: proxmox-cloud-controller-manager
- app.kubernetes.io/version: "v0.4.1"
+ app.kubernetes.io/version: "v0.4.2"
app.kubernetes.io/managed-by: Helm
namespace: kube-system
---
@@ -18,10 +18,10 @@ kind: ClusterRole
metadata:
name: system:proxmox-cloud-controller-manager
labels:
- helm.sh/chart: proxmox-cloud-controller-manager-0.2.2
+ helm.sh/chart: proxmox-cloud-controller-manager-0.2.3
app.kubernetes.io/name: proxmox-cloud-controller-manager
app.kubernetes.io/instance: proxmox-cloud-controller-manager
- app.kubernetes.io/version: "v0.4.1"
+ app.kubernetes.io/version: "v0.4.2"
app.kubernetes.io/managed-by: Helm
rules:
- apiGroups:
@@ -106,10 +106,10 @@ kind: Deployment
metadata:
name: proxmox-cloud-controller-manager
labels:
- helm.sh/chart: proxmox-cloud-controller-manager-0.2.2
+ helm.sh/chart: proxmox-cloud-controller-manager-0.2.3
app.kubernetes.io/name: proxmox-cloud-controller-manager
app.kubernetes.io/instance: proxmox-cloud-controller-manager
- app.kubernetes.io/version: "v0.4.1"
+ app.kubernetes.io/version: "v0.4.2"
app.kubernetes.io/managed-by: Helm
namespace: kube-system
spec:
@@ -148,7 +148,7 @@ spec:
- ALL
seccompProfile:
type: RuntimeDefault
- image: "ghcr.io/sergelogvinov/proxmox-cloud-controller-manager:v0.4.1"
+ image: "ghcr.io/sergelogvinov/proxmox-cloud-controller-manager:v0.4.2"
imagePullPolicy: Always
args:
- --v=4